@mod @mod_forum
Feature: A user can view their posts and discussions
In order to ensure a user can view their posts and discussions
As a student
I need to view my post and discussions
Scenario: View the student's posts and discussions
Given the following "users" exist:
| username | firstname | lastname | email |
| student1 | Student | 1 | student1@example.com |
And the following "courses" exist:
| fullname | shortname | category |
| Course 1 | C1 | 0 |
And the following "course enrolments" exist:
| user | course | role |
| student1 | C1 | student |
And the following "activities" exist:
| activity | name | course | idnumber | groupmode |
| forum | Test forum name | C1 | forum | 0 |
And the following "mod_forum > discussions" exist:
| user | forum | name | message |
| student1 | forum | Forum discussion 1 | How awesome is this forum discussion? |
And the following "mod_forum > posts" exist:
| user | parentsubject | subject | message |
| student1 | Forum discussion 1 | Actually, I've seen better. | Actually, I've seen better. |
And I log in as "student1"
When I follow "Profile" in the user menu
And I follow "Forum posts"
Then I should see "How awesome is this forum discussion?"
And I should see "Actually, I've seen better."
And I follow "Profile" in the user menu
And I follow "Forum discussions"
And I should see "How awesome is this forum discussion?"
And I should not see "Actually, I've seen better."
